General description

Bands may be observed for reduced protein bands at ~ 24 kDa (unglycosylated) and ~ 30 kDa (glycosylated). Additional TIMP-3 bands MAY be visible at 50 kDa (dimer), 12 kDa, and 15 kDa (breakdown products) and sample dependent.
Tissue inhibitor of metalloproteinases 3 (TIMP-3) is a member of the TIMP family. The TIMPs are so named because they are slow, tight binding endogenous inhibitors of the Matrix Metalloproteinases (MMPs). The four TIMPs have different inhibition constants for the different MMPs studied. TIMPs have been shown to have activity against the ADAMs family of proteinases. TIMP-3 is an efficient "sheddase" inhibitor, inhibiting ADAM-17 (TACE) at the low nanomolar levels seen with MMP inhibition. The other ADAMs proteinases have not yet been assayed for TIMP inhibition, but TIMP-2 seems to be much less active on ADAM-17 than isTIMP-3. TIMP-3 is thought to be constitutively produced by many cell types and is inducible in others. The TIMP-3 localization differs from the other 3 TIMPs, and is thought to be primarily deposited into the extracellular matrix.
